Private E T COOK

Service Number: M2/047644
Regiment & Unit/Ship

Army Service Corps

37th M.T. Ammunition Sub Park

Date of Death

Died 20 March 1917

Age 32 years old

Buried or commemorated at

FAUBOURG D'AMIENS CEMETERY, ARRAS

II. J. 3.

France

Commonwealth War Graves Commission - Headstone Placeholder
  • Country of Service United Kingdom
  • Additional Info Born in London. Son of William and Ellen Cook; husband of Eva Gwendoline Cook, of Spa Terrace, Askern, Doncaster.
  • Personal Inscription WE CANNOT LORD THY PURPOSE SEE BUT ALL IS WELL THAT'S DONE BY THEE
